## Workflow

### 1. Resolve Locations First

City names are ambiguous — "London" = LHR, LGW, STN, LCY, LTN. Always resolve first:

```bash
letsfg locations "London"
# LON  London (all airports)
# LHR  Heathrow
# LGW  Gatwick
```

```python
locations = bt.resolve_location("London")
# Use city code "LON" for all airports, or specific airport "LHR"
```

### 2. Search (FREE, Unlimited)

```python
flights = bt.search("LON", "BCN", "2026-04-01")
# Round trip:
flights = bt.search("LON", "BCN", "2026-04-01", return_date="2026-04-08")
# Multi-passenger, business class:
flights = bt.search("LHR", "SIN", "2026-06-01", adults=2, children=1, cabin_class="C")
```

```bash
letsfg search LON BCN 2026-04-01 --return 2026-04-08 --sort price --json
```

Search returns structured offers:

```json
{
  "passenger_ids": ["pas_0"],
  "total_results": 47,
  "offers": [{
    "id": "off_xxx",
    "price": 89.50,
    "currency": "EUR",
    "airlines": ["Ryanair"],
    "route": "STN → BCN",
    "duration_seconds": 7800,
    "stopovers": 0,
    "conditions": {
      "refund_before_departure": "not_allowed",
      "change_before_departure": "allowed_with_fee"
    }
  }]
}
```

## Critical Rules

1. **Use REAL passenger details** — airlines send e-tickets to the contact email. Names must match passport/ID exactly. Never use placeholder or fake data.
2. **Always provide `idempotency_key` when booking** — prevents duplicate reservations if the agent retries on timeout.
3. **Resolve locations before searching** — "New York" = JFK, LGA, EWR, NYC. Use `resolve_location()` first.
4. **Search is free** — search as many routes, dates, and cabin classes as needed.
5. **Map passenger IDs** — search returns `passenger_ids`. Each booking passenger must include the correct `id`.

## Error Handling

| Error | Category | Action |
|-------|----------|--------|
| `SUPPLIER_TIMEOUT` (504) | Transient | Retry after 1-5s |
| `RATE_LIMITED` (429) | Transient | Wait and retry |
| `INVALID_IATA` (422) | Validation | Use `resolve_location()` to fix |
| `OFFER_EXPIRED` (410) | Business | Search again for fresh offers |
| `PAYMENT_REQUIRED` (402) | Business | PFS: connect a card at the `add_card_url` (https://letsfg.co/connect). Developer API: `letsfg setup-payment` |
| `FARE_CHANGED` (409) | Business | Re-unlock to get current price |

## Search Flags

| Flag | Default | Description |
|------|---------|-------------|
| `--return` / `-r` | _(one-way)_ | Return date (YYYY-MM-DD) |
| `--adults` / `-a` | `1` | Number of adults (1–9) |
| `--children` | `0` | Children (2–11 years) |
| `--cabin` / `-c` | _(any)_ | `M` economy, `W` premium, `C` business, `F` first |
| `--max-stops` / `-s` | `2` | Max stopovers (0–4) |
| `--currency` | `EUR` | Currency code |
| `--limit` / `-l` | `20` | Max results (1–100) |
| `--sort` | `price` | `price` or `duration` |
| `--json` / `-j` | | JSON output |
